The story was based on a journal Porter kept in 1931 during her sea voyage from Mexico to Germany, and the characters in the novel were based on real people she met during the trip.

The 1965 film adaptation by Abby Mann was directed by Stanley Kramer and headlined a galaxy of stars including Vivien Leigh, Oskar Werner, Jose Ferrer, Simone Signoret, Lee Marvin and others. It won Oscars for cinematography and art direction.
